Novo Nordisk takes action on insulin 'pen'

By Andrew Jack in London

Published: July 18 2007 03:00 | Last updated: July 18 2007 03:00

Novo Nordisk, the Danish pharmaceutical group focused on diabetes care, has begun legal action in the US to block the launch of a new insulin product produced by its French rival Sanofi-Aventis.

Novo Nordisk is seeking an injunction because it claims Sanofi-Aventis' Solo-Star injection pen combined with Lantus insulin - recently approved by the US Food & Drug Administration - infringes the patents on its NovoPen 4.
